Talent base



Say what you will about Danny, but he has pretty well
blown up our roster since draft day:

SUBTRACTED: Walker, Delk, Williams, Battie, Brown,
Bremer, Sundov

ADDED: Davis, LaFrentz, Jones, Mihm, Welsch, Stewart,
Mills

On paper, anyway, the latter list arguably is more
talented top to bottom, and on average is younger
(though not more athletic). If Welsch can keep
developing, and Raef comes back healthy, these could
well be winning moves. Time will tell. 

I expect Obie to keep Welsch as the starting SF and
try to sell Davis on the idea of being our sixth man
extraordinaire. I expect to see three-guard lineups
with Welsch at the point and Ricky or Pierce at the
three. 

With no Battie and no Raef, Mihm will have to really
come into his own. Statistically speaking, he could
average a double-double if given 30 minutes a night.
(He is fifth in the league in rebounds per 48
minutes). Now let's see if he can really handle it.

PS: If the prognosis for Raef's surgery is a 4-month
recovery, why is ESPN writing that his season is over?
Doesn't it seem possible he could come back for the
last month of the season, and the playoffs?
